AGRICULTURAL IMPLEMENT WITH EASILY SERVICED TRUNNION
An agricultural implement includes a frame and an adjustment system on the frame. The adjustment system includes a first component and a second component connected by a trunnion connection. The trunnion connection includes first and second opposed confronting trunnion blocks, each defining a hole therethrough, the holes being aligned one with the other. A trunnion shaft is disposed in the holes of the trunnion blocks and has ends extending beyond outer surfaces of the trunnion blocks. At least one end of the trunnion shaft defines an opening therethrough. End stops are provided at each end of the trunnion shaft, at least one of the end stops having a portion insertable into the opening. The end stops are larger than the aligned holes to prevent withdrawal of the trunnion shaft from the trunnion blocks.
AUTOMATED LEVELING AND DEPTH CONTROL SYSTEM OF A WORK MACHINE AND METHOD THEREOF
An agricultural implement includes a transversely extending frame forming a first, a second, and a third frame section. A first actuator is coupled to the first frame section, a second actuator coupled to the second frame section, and a third actuator coupled to the third frame section. Sensors are coupled to each frame section to detect a height of the respective frame section relative to an underlying surface. A control unit is disposed in electrical communication with the sensors and operably controls the actuators to adjust the height of each frame section.

TILLAGE IMPLEMENT WITH PRELOAD ASSEMBLY
A tillage implement, a tillage machine, and a method of tilling soil is provided. The tillage implement includes a mounting bracket that couples to a rolling frame, a shank pivotably coupled to the mounting bracket via a hinge assembly, a soil working tool operatively coupled to a distal end of the shank, and a preload assembly for moving the shank to a loaded position that is rotationally offset from an unloaded position. The tillage machine includes a rolling frame that is pulled by a tow vehicle when tilling a field and multiple ones of the tillage implements operatively coupled to the rolling frame that contact and till the field. And the method includes attaching the tillage implement to a rolling frame, preloading the hinge assembly by moving the shank to a loaded position that is rotationally offset from the unloaded position, and contacting the soil with the soil working tool.
Variable angle disc hub for a tiller jump arm assembly
A jump arm assembly for a tilling machine includes a jump arm and a disc hub assembly. The jump arm has a first end coupled to a frame unit of the tilling machine and a second end opposite the first end. The disc hub assembly includes a an arm end configured to be fixedly secured to the second end of the jump arm, and an opposing disc end. A first plane defined by the arm end of the disc hub assembly is arranged in non-parallel relation with respect to a second plane defined by the disc end of the disc hub assembly.

Tillage apparatuses and related methods
An apparatus, which may be a tillage apparatus, has a flexible frame. The frame may be made from open members. The frame may support ground engagers and may be supported on wheel assemblies. The ground engagers may be connected to a spring trip mechanism. The ground engagers may be mounted to open members of the frame with a clamping style mechanism. The clamp mechanism may include wedge devices. The frame may be lowered and raised relative to wheels of the wheel assemblies with a lift mechanism. One row of ground engagers may be raised or lowered relative to the frame independent of another row of ground engagers. An anti-skid or skew control system may be employed in association with the independent height adjustment of one row of ground engagers. A system may be provided to maintain and control the height of a tow hitch forming part of the apparatus.
Gang angle adjustment for a work machine and method thereof
An agricultural implement includes a transversely extending frame forming at least a first frame section, a second frame section, and a third frame section, where the first frame section is disposed between the second and third frame sections. A pair of elongated gang assemblies are on the first frame section, an elongated gang assembly is on the second frame section, and an elongated gang assembly is on the third frame section. Each of the gang assemblies is horizontally adjustable relative to the frame. An actuator for each gang assembly operably controls the angular adjustment of the gang assemblies, and a fluid source supplies fluid to the actuators. The actuator on the second frame section is a master actuator for one of the actuators on the first frame section, and the actuator on the third frame section is a master actuator for the other actuator on the first frame section.

Tiller jump arm wearplate spacer
A tilling machine includes a frame having a jump arm frame unit and a plurality of jump arm assemblies supported along a length of the jump arm frame unit such that a lateral gap is defined between each adjacent pair of jump arm assemblies of the plurality of jump arm assemblies. Additionally, the tilling machine includes a plurality of jump arm spacers, with each jump arm spacer being provided in operative association with a clamp unit of a respective jump arm assembly of the plurality of jump arm assemblies to maintain the lateral gap between each adjacent pair of jump arm assemblies.
